> This is docker container for eagle to help users to have a quick preview 
> about eagle features. And this project is to build apache/eagle images and 
> provide eagle-functions to start the containers of eagle.
> Prerequisite
> =========
> Docker environment (see https://www.docker.com)
> Installation & Usage
> ===============
> 1. [Build Image]: Go to the root directory where the Dockerfile is in, build 
> image with following command:
> {code}
> docker built -t apache/eagle . 
> {code}
> The docker image is named apache/eagle. Eagle docker image is based on 
> ambari:1.7.0, it will install ganglia, hbase,hive,storm,kafka and so on in 
> this image. Add startup script and buleprint file into image.
> 2. [Verify Image: After building the apache/eagle image successfully, verify 
> the images and could find eagle image.
> {code}
> docker images
> {code}
> 3. [Deploy Image]: This project also provides helper functions in script 
> eagle-functions for convenience.
> {code}
> # Firstly, load the helper functions into context
> source eagle-functions
> # Secondly, start to deploy eagle cluster
> # (1) start single-node container
> eagle-deploy-cluster 1 
> # (2) Or muti-node containers
> eagle-deploy-cluster 3 
> {code}
> 4. [Find IP and Port Mapping]: After the container is up and running. The 
> first thing you need to do is finding the IP address and port mapping of the 
> docker container:
> {code}
> docker inspect -f '{{ .NetworkSettings.IPAddress }}' eagle-server
> docker ps
> {code}
> 5. [Start to use Eagle]: Congratulations! You are able to start using Eagle 
> now. Please open eagle ui at following address (username: ADMIN, password: 
> secret by default)
> {code}
> http://{{container_ip}}:9099  
> {code}
> 6. [Manage Eagle Cluster]: This step is about how to managing the eagle 
> cluster though not must-have at starting. Eagle docker depends on Ambari to 
> manage the cluster infrastructure of Eagle. Following are some helpful links:
> * Ambari UI: http://{{container_ip}}:8080 (username: ADMIN, password: ADMIN)
> * Storm UI: http://{{container_ip}}:8744
